Maggie Vanderwall

Biography

Raised just outside Iowa City, Maggie Vandewalle went to the University of Iowa on an art scholarship and has been painting ever since. Although her studies at UI were focused initially on printmaking, she fell in love with watercolors. Now, painting is her primary medium, and she creates beautiful, off-kilter work that makes you question the evidence of your eyes. Vandewalle paints what should be there instead of what is, teasing at a world existing beneath, or beside, our own. Her paintings are reminders of the truths we saw more clearly as children. Vandewalle left Iowa for Tennessee 14 years ago, but her work is still carried by Catiri’s Art Oasis, a gallery in Amana that has grown up alongside her, carrying her early work when it first opened 17 years ago.
